LINDSEY LUBIANSKI OF TRINITY UNIVERSITY, a sophomore middle blocker from Saint Hedwig, Texas, has been named the SCAC Volleyball Offensive Player-of-the-Week for matches played from Friday, October 27 through Saturday, October 28.
Lubianski finished with 21 kills (2.33/set) and a .444 hitting percentage over nine sets played. She committed just five errors in 36 attempts, as well as recording seven total blocks.
Lubianski was named the Tournament MVP for her performance, and is also the SCAC leader in hitting percentage at .444.
Other impressive performances in the SCAC:
Sophomore setter Lizzy Counts of Colorado College was voted tournament MVP for her performance at the Spike It Up Classic. She helped the Tigers hit .369 as a team. Senior outside hitter Dani DeWitt of Austin College led the 'Roos with 2.92 kills-per-set and a .345 hitting percentage as Austin College went 4-1 in five matches. She also added a pair of service aces to her stats sheet. Junior outside hitter Jamison Duck of Southwestern University hit an impressive .476 in the Pirates' 3-0 sweep over Our Lady of the Lakes and added 13 kills in the five-set win over St. Mary's. Freshman middle blocker Cailey Young of Texas Lutheran University tallied 13 kills in matches played this weekend at the Tiger Invitational. In the match against Concordia, Young hit an impressive .375 with 6 kills on zero errors to go along with the only solo block of the match.
